Three African powerhouses have been tipped by an ex-Nigeria star as the favourites to win the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ations, scheduled to kick off in Ivory Coast next year.

Senegal will aim to defend the title they won two years ago as the continent's 24 best teams get set to contest Africa’s biggest football prize from January 13 to February 11.

According to Punch, former Super Eagles forward Mutiu Adepoju, who won the tournament with Nigeria in 1994, believes the AFCON 2023 title will come down to one of three countries.

"We will wait until the tournament starts and see how it ends but I know Nigeria are among the favourites to win it. I will also tip Egypt and Senegal but it is going to be difficult to say who will be the winner until the championship starts."

Each of these nations has a rich pedigree at the AFCON, with the Super Eagles winning it three times and the Pharaohs having won the championship a record seven times.
